Southdown Motor Services Ltd was established in 1915 and operated bus and coach services in the southern England, mainly in East and West Sussex and parts of Hampshire. In 1969, Southdown was purchased by the National Bus Company and which in turn was purchased by the Stagecoach Group in 1989.

This badge features the National Bus Company’s ‘double N’ arrow logo and its regional bus company name. The red and blue ‘double N’ logo was introduced in 1978. Southdown was privatised in 1987 and it’s likely by this time, the ‘double N’ logo had been phased out.
